https://teachhoops.com/ The evolution of practice planning represents a massive shift from linear, repetitive instruction to dynamic, ecological environments. In the "Old School" era, practices were often characterized by long lines, 15-minute "lecture" sessions, and "blocked" practice—where a player would shoot 50 identical jump shots from the same spot with no defense. Modern science has shown us that while this builds "form," it doesn't build "transferable skill." Today’s elite planners prioritize "Variable Practice", where no two reps are ever exactly the same. By constantly changing the distance, the angle, or the defensive pressure, you force the brain to "re-solve" the movement problem every single time, leading to more resilient habits on game night. We have moved away from "The Drill" and toward "The Small-Sided Game (SSG)." In the past, defensive "Shell Drill" was a static, choreographed exercise. Today, coaches utilize "Constraint-Led" games—like 3-on-3 "No Dribble" or 4-on-4 "Baseline Trap Only"—to teach tactical concepts. This shift focuses on building "Basketball IQ" and "Perception-Action Coupling". Instead of a coach telling a player where to pass, the environment (the "constraint") forces the player to see the open window. In the mid-season January grind, this prevents "mental stagnation" and keeps players engaged because they are playing a game rather than performing a chore. Finally, the modern practice plan has embraced "Analytics-Driven Periodization." We no longer "run them until they quit" just to prove toughness. Today’s plans use the Acute:Chronic Workload Ratio ($ACWR$) to ensure players peak at the right time. Practices are scripted with "Load Management" in mind, alternating between high-intensity "Competition Days" and low-impact "Tactical Refinement Days." Utilizing digital tools—like those discussed in TeachHoops member calls—allows coaches to share practice scripts and film clips with players before they step on the floor. This "Flipped Classroom" approach ensures that 100% of your hardwood time is dedicated to high-speed execution rather than slow-speed installation.
